William Regal

Stats

Height: 6’2”
Weight: 240 pounds
Weight Class: Heavyweight
From : Blackpool, England
Career Highlights : Intercontinental Champion; World Tag Team Champion; European Champion; Hardcore Champion; WCW Television Champion; WWE Commissioner; Alliance Commissioner; Raw General Manager; 2008 WWE King of the Ring

Attributes

Strike Power: 75
Grapple Power : 75
Submission: 85
Strike Defense: 65
Grapple Defense: 80
Speed : 65
Agility: 65
Adrenaline : 75
Recovery : 75
Durability : 65
Charisma: 75
Tag Team : 75
Overall : 79

Bio

Normally, William Regal is one of WWE’s most smug and haughty Superstars. A distinguished Englishman, Regal finds most others crass and downright unworthy of his time.

While presenting himself as a dignified man away from the ring, Regal is a sadistic mat technician inside the squared circle, taking great pleasure in torturing his adversaries with stiff strikes and brutal submission holds.

Learning the ropes as a young teenager, the native of Blackpool, England, traveled across the United Kingdom wrestling in carnivals.

Facing off against challengers from the carnival circuit as well as from the crowd, Regal quickly garnered a reputation as a lethal opponent, with fists of iron and dozens of different holds to render his adversaries helpless.

Always interested in sharpening his tools as an in-ring competitor, Regal traveled across the world, winning several championships in Europe, the Middle East, and Japan.

After finding further success in WCW, Regal carved his tremendous legacy in WWE, winning numerous championships and accolades that would forever cement his place of greatness.

His crowning achievement, however, was when he became truly regal, winning the prestigious 2008 WWE King of the Ring Tournament.

Part English gentleman, part Blackpool brawler, Sir William Regal stands as one of the most dangerous grapplers on the WWE roster today. And there is no telling when the fierce competitor will drop his more dignified persona to put a disagreeable Superstar in his place.

Breakdown

William Regal plays a key role in the Road to WrestleMania, so you’ll get to know him well. For such a pompous Superstar, his attributes fall to the lower end of each category, and he ends up with just a 79 Overall rating.

His best attribute is an 85 in Submission, but arguably his best technique is the Power of the Punch, where he slaps on a set of brass knuckles and unloads a vicious, looping overhand left to his opponent’s head. Use this to set up a Finisher.
